    Exclamation Attachments with file name

    After attaching a file into Microsoft access it just shows me a logo of the attachments in Sent Files and Feedback Files but how do I get the file name to appear next to them as well? Is there a code that needs to be written to do so?

    Review this http://www.cimaware.com/resources/article_135.html

    Go to the part about showing attachments on report.

    This might not be suitable for a form. The purpose of attachment control on form is to add attachments to the record. Use report to show the attachments and info.
